Hit-and-run driver kills man at Riverside and West 147th

A hit-and-run driver hit a 47-year-old male pedestrian at Riverside Drive and West 147th Street in Manhattan early September 4, 2022, and police said the man died at Harlem Hospital after suffering head trauma.

What We Know

At about 2:42 a.m. on September 4, 2022, a driver in a northbound Jeep SUV was recorded in a fatal pedestrian collision at Riverside Drive and West 147th Street in Manhattan. Police told the New York Post that a hit-and-run driver hit the man around 2:45 a.m., left the scene, and that the 47-year-old pedestrian died at Harlem Hospital after head trauma. The official record lists one pedestrian death and no other injuries, and attributes a contributing factor to pedestrian error or confusion.

West 147th Street has a record of injury crashes

The collision happened at Riverside Drive and West 147th Street in Manhattan. CrashCountNYC's location context for West 147th Street in Manhattan shows 68 crashes, 36 injuries, 2 serious injuries and 1 death from the start of 2022 through June 1, 2026. That history places this death within a corridor with recurring injury crashes.
